On the other hand, the photoblocker do work, even the cops admit to that. But at the same time they also state that it's not legal. But the thing is, you can't really tell it's there, unless the cops are going to start photographing every plate they see to tell if it has photoblocker or not. Hardly lightly at all.
It was also tested by teknikens verld (Technical world) in sweden by the government tv, and yep, it works. The overexpose is just how it works, it reflext too much light, so the cameras in the speedbox'es can't get a decent pic.
